Job opening: Staff Accountant (Senior)

Salary: $132 368 - 172 075 per year
Published at: Oct 06 2023
Employment Type: Full-time
This position is located at Departmental Offices, Domestic Finance. As a Senior Staff Accountant, you will serve in the office the Federal Financing Bank, under the general supervision of the Supervisory Accountant of FFB. Incumbent will exercise responsibility over only a portion of the account covered by this position.

Duties

As a Senior Staff Accountant, you will: Provide expert advice on a variety of complex and unique accounting problems and prepares technical reports, analyses and exhibits on findings, recommendations and alternatives for FFB's Director of Accounting. Support accounting system development for FFB's Loan Management and Control System (LMCS), including but not limited to, authoring and reviewing functional requirements for system changes, enhancements and fixes, conducting user acceptance testing (UAT) for system changes, writing test plans for system development and enhancement work, and liaising with intern IT staff on issues affecting the LMCS system. Conduct research and analyses for various accounting, financial, and budgeting processes used by the Federal Financing Bank (FFB) in support of its overall financial management responsibilities. Coordinate the interface of GOALS, ECS, TIER and other external computer systems with the operations of the FFB and the LMCS. Review monthly TIER transmissions and other reports and work product drafted by other FFB staff accountants.

Qualifications

You must meet the following requirements within 30 days of the closing date of this announcement. Basic Requirements for Accountant 0510 series: A. Degree: accounting; or a degree in a related field such as business administration, finance, or public administration that included or was supplemented by 24 semester hours in accounting. The 24 hours may include up to 6 hours of credit in business law. (The term "accounting" means "accounting and/or auditing" in this standard. Similarly, "accountant" should be interpreted, generally, as "accountant and/or auditor.") OR B. Combination of education and experience -- at least 4 years of experience in accounting, or an equivalent combination of accounting experience, college-level education, and training that provided professional accounting knowledge. The applicant's background must also include one of the following:1. Twenty-four semester hours in accounting or auditing courses of appropriate type and quality. This can include up to 6 hours of business law; OR 2. A certificate as Certified Public Accountant or a Certified Internal Auditor, obtained through written examination; OR 3. Completion of the requirements for a degree that included substantial course work in accounting or auditing, e.g., 15 semester hours, but that does not fully satisfy the 24-semester-hour requirement of paragraph A, provided that (a) the applicant has successfully worked at the full-performance level in accounting, auditing, or a related field, e.g., valuation engineering or financial institution examining; (b) a panel of at least two higher level professional accountants or auditors has determined that the applicant has demonstrated a good knowledge of accounting and of related and underlying fields that equals in breadth, depth, currency, and level of advancement that which is normally associated with successful completion of the 4-year course of study described in paragraph A; and (c) except for literal nonconformance to the requirement of 24 semester hours in accounting, the applicant's education, training, and experience fully meet the specified requirements. SPECIALIZED EXPERIENCE: For the GS-14, you must have one year of specialized experience at a level of difficulty and responsibility equivalent to the GS-13 grade level in the Federal service. Specialized Experience for this position includes: - Experience conducting or overseeing accounting audits or responses to accounting audits in conformity with professional and regulatory standards; AND -Experience researching accounting policies and regulatory guidelines to provide authoritative recommendations to management; AND - Experience analyzing internal accounting and financial reporting systems for adequacy and recommending technical modifications and improvements. TIME-IN-GRADE: In addition to the above requirements, you must meet the following time-in-grade requirement, if applicable: For the GS-14, you must have been at the GS-13 level for 52 weeks. TIME AFTER COMPETITIVE APPOINTMENT: Candidates who are current Federal employees serving on a non-temporary competitive appointment must have served at least three months in that appointment.
